[PATCH] target/riscv: trans_rvv: Avoid assert for RV32 and e64

When running a 32-bit guest, with a e64 vmv.v.x and vl_eq_vlmax set to
true the `tcg_debug_assert(vece <= MO_32)` will be triggered inside
tcg_gen_gvec_dup_i32().
This patch checks that condition and instead uses tcg_gen_gvec_dup_i64()
is required.

target/riscv/insn_trans/trans_rvv.c.inc | 12 ++++++++++--
1 file changed, 10 insertions(+), 2 deletions(-)
diff --git a/target/riscv/insn_trans/trans_rvv.c.inc
b/target/riscv/insn_trans/trans_rvv.c.inc
index 391c61fe93..6b27d8e91e 100644
--- a/target/riscv/insn_trans/trans_rvv.c.inc
+++ b/target/riscv/insn_trans/trans_rvv.c.inc
@@ -2097,8 +2097,16 @@ static bool trans_vmv_v_x(DisasContext *s, arg_vmv_v_x
*a)
s1 = get_gpr(s, a->rs1, EXT_SIGN);
if (s->vl_eq_vlmax) {
- tcg_gen_gvec_dup_tl(s->sew, vreg_ofs(s, a->rd),
- MAXSZ(s), MAXSZ(s), s1);
+ if (get_xl(s) == MXL_RV32 && s->sew == MO_64) {
+ TCGv_i64 s1_i64 = tcg_temp_new_i64();
+ tcg_gen_ext_tl_i64(s1_i64, s1);
+ tcg_gen_gvec_dup_i64(s->sew, vreg_ofs(s, a->rd),
+ MAXSZ(s), MAXSZ(s), s1_i64);
+ tcg_temp_free_i64(s1_i64);
+ } else {
+ tcg_gen_gvec_dup_tl(s->sew, vreg_ofs(s, a->rd),
+ MAXSZ(s), MAXSZ(s), s1);
+ }
} else {
TCGv_i32 desc;
TCGv_i64 s1_i64 = tcg_temp_new_i64();
